Konstantin Grcic

Berlin, Germany

Furniture, product and lighting designer Konstantin Grcic trained as a cabinet maker at The John Makepeace School in Dorset, England, before completing his studies in Design at the Royal College of Art in London. He founded his own studio in 1991 in Munich. Under the name of Konstantin Grcic Industrial Design (KGID), the practice has completed an array of designs for renowned companies around the world, including Mattiazzi, Nespresso, Muji, and Vitra. From 2004, the studio has also created a series of limited-edition designs for Galerie Kreo in Paris. The designer’s distinctive pared-down style blends clear forms and playful details with cues from the world of architecture and the history of design. Konstantin Grcic’s work has been awarded the prestigious Compasso d`Oro in 2001 and 2011, with works also included in the permanent collections of museums such as MoMA, NYC and Centre Georges Pompidou, Paris.
